Product Technical Specialist (Size & Fit) - Photostudio
Role Responsibility
As a Product Technical Specialist (Size & Fit), 5 days on site you will be working hands-on with garments and accessories coming through the Photostudio, writing accurate and informative product attributes to help build the Selfridges reputation as an authoritative fashion destination. Sitting in the Product Technical Specialist Team which makes up part of the Content Team, you will play a key role in delivering our product offering to our online customer and be integral to the smooth running of a fast-paced ecommerce studio environment.
You will be required to work independently and quickly to capture, upload and format technical product information for womenswear and menswear fashion and accessories, from high-street to high-end. You will manage your own workload to meet strict deadlines while liaising daily with multiple teams on product workflow and brand information.
Responsibilities:
1. Write up to 90 technical product descriptions a day for womenswear, menswear and accessories products (including size and fit information, fabric composition and care information)
2. Write in accordance with the Selfridges style guides, consistently and accurately formatting details and proof-reading your own work
3. Work closely with the Copywriters on product workflow, communicating updates, STEP upgrade and reacting to change requests
4. Work closely with the on-set Styling & Photography team on true to size of garments and record accurate information, communicating updates and reacting to change requests
5. Liaise daily with Styling and Photography teams on product workflow and priorities
6. Conduct daily site walks for fashion products to maintain quality, consistency and accuracy
7. Liaise daily with the Digital Operations and Buying teams on product attributes and brand information/requirements
8. Manage your own time, prioritising your workload to meet deadlines in a fast-paced studio environment
9. Stay up to date with seasonal fashion trends, have a solid brand awareness, and demonstrate your departmental and general experience.
10. Work collaboratively with the rest of the Content team to continuously optimise and improve our product descriptions
